It is required to teach robots without stopping production lines. To meet the requirement an off-line teaching system using a personal computer has been developed. In the system a 3-dimensional workpiece model is generated from 2-dimensional information of drawings. The operator can graphically teach the robot the path of the end-effector and examine the program by viewing animated robot motion on the CRT. The system reduces the time to teach robots and provides robotics manufacturing with higher productivity.